Output 905b120574ce699c864febaf4e056c330004a9a866ebaae2b9088f919b7101b5:7

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d85c52f99dc348ec85cb1fc66b5da75bf5f5050 OP_EQUAL
address
3D8ie3StuNkk55fKh31UA3Wawc9jX4Xjwg
transaction
905b120574ce699c864febaf4e056c330004a9a866ebaae2b9088f919b7101b5